Arbitrary file upload in OpenEMR - CVE-2018-15139
Published: August 13, 2018 / Updated: November 25, 2021
Vulnerability details
The vulnerability allows a remote authenticated user to execute arbitrary code.
Unrestricted file upload in interface/super/manage_site_files.php in versions of OpenEMR before 5.0.1.4 allows a remote authenticated attacker to execute arbitrary PHP code by uploading a file with a PHP extension via the images upload form and accessing it in the images directory.
